Away from fireworks

We spend New Year’s Eves traditionally in forests, preferably as remote and deep as possible. Why? Because we have two dogs and one of them is extremely afraid of fireworks.

Every year, the plan is to find some nice outdoor destination where we can spend the whole day. This year we decided to go to the Luukki recreational area, Espoo, and do The Trail of the Seven Ponds.

In addition to the fact that the trail is interesting to hike, it opens a whole new world for geocachers. There are a lot of caches around the ponds, and the set is genuinely nice. Without hesitation, I can recommend it as a day trip destination to anyone.

All the ponds on this trail are different, and there are different stories behind each of them.

1) Hepolampi (“Horse Lake” in English, because it was used as a drinking place for horses.
People have been fishing there forever, and it has been said that there are dugout canoes lying at the bottom, but I didn’t see any)

2) Hauklampi (the main photo of this article was taken there)

3) Kierlampi (shallow, smallish pond)

4) Mustalampi (jet black marshy pond)

5) Väärälampi (we made some coffee here)

6) Halkolampi (great campfire spots, we ate our lunch here)

7) Kaitalampi (a famous swimming place, has also many campfire spots. Near a car park, BUT it means there are always a lot of people here)

In addition to the caches that belonged to the set of the Trail of the Seven Ponds, there were a few bonus caches that were nice to find.

The trip was versatile with many different views and landscapes, and it felt like we had been gone longer than we actually were. It is easy to orient in this area if you walk along the paths and follow the signs. But if you want to step off the path and wander in the forest, a GPS won’t be an unnecessary device.

When we got back home, the dogs were tired, and the owners invigorated. We enjoyed our champagne at the balcony admiring the fireworks, while the dogs were hiding inside, sleeping.
